TCS with Google Cloud to offer AI-enabled security solutions

Arshi Khan by Arshi Khan
September 3, 2024
TCS cybersecurity solution

Tata Consultancy Services (TCS), an IT service provider, has expanded its partnership with Google Cloud to offer two solutions, the TCS Managed Detection and Response (MDR) solution and the TCS Secure Cloud Foundation solution.

The TCS Managed Detection and Response (MDR) solution, powered by Google Security Operations, will enable security teams to reduce the time required to detect and respond to threats. It combines the hyperscaler’s advanced threat detection capabilities with TCS’ contextual knowledge to enable continuous security monitoring and round-the-clock response.

The TCS Secure Cloud Foundation leverages capabilities from Google Cloud’s security solutions to strengthen cloud security posture and governance across single, multi, and hybrid cloud environments by embedding security and compliance guardrails throughout the DevSecOps lifecycle. Leveraging AI, machine learning, and automation, the solution continuously monitors risks, identifies deviations, and recommends remedial actions.

The expanded partnership will leverage Google Cloud’s AI-powered security portfolio across threat intelligence, security operations, and cloud security. TCS and Google Cloud will help clients secure their cloud transformation journeys by offering tailored solutions at a global scale, along with local expertise to adhere to regulatory compliance.

TCS has already successfully deployed both solutions to several of its clients. For example, the Secure Cloud Foundation solution has assisted a global bank headquartered in Germany.

Ganesa Subramanian, VP and Global Head of Cybersecurity Business Group, TCS, said, “Businesses are rapidly transforming, and they must secure their transformation journey to grow with confidence. The rise of Generative AI further underscores the need to modernize cybersecurity and strengthen cyber resilience. This partnership brings together the best of capabilities, contextual knowledge, and accelerators from TCS and Google Cloud to holistically protect the digital estates of enterprise customers, to help them be future-ready, cyber resilient businesses.”

Nidhi Srivastava, Vice President and Executive Champion for Google Cloud, TCS, said, “TCS’ expanded partnership with Google Cloud provides two unique, AI-powered, cross-industry, enterprise solutions – the TCS Managed Detection and Response Solution and the TCS Secure Cloud Foundation – to help our clients combat advanced cybersecurity threats. Our deep industry knowledge, comprehensive portfolio, and ability to scale on Google Cloud enables us to rapidly create value for our customers.”

In a partnership spanning a decade, TCS and Google Cloud have helped global enterprises transform their businesses with the power of the cloud.

Peter Bailey, Vice President and General Manager of Security Operations of Google Cloud, said, “TCS and Google Cloud have partnered for many years to help customers harness the power of the cloud and AI to grow and transform their business. The integration of Google Security Operations into TCS MDR and Secure Cloud Foundation solutions is a natural evolution of this partnership, enabling TCS and their customers to leverage Google SecOps planet-level scalability, searchability, integrated and AI-assisted investigation and response workflows, and applied Mandiant Threat Intelligence. Together, we can help customer organizations dramatically improve their security posture and ability to respond to threats in real-time.”

TCS’ cybersecurity offerings range from consulting and implementation to managed security services across industry-specific challenges and address them. With over 16,000 cybersecurity professionals on its roster, TCS helps over 600 enterprises across the globe protect their entire digital estate and improve their security posture.
